- However, the cost of dental braces without insurance, generally, is about $6,000 to $7,000.
- If you don't have coverage, you might be wondering "just how much do dental braces cost without insurance policy", and we do not condemn you.
- According to the American Dental Organization's oral fees study, the average expense of dental braces was in between $4,800 to $7,135.
- These are transparent aligners that can be optimal for patients who wish to align their teeth with every one of the discretion in the world.
- This expense varies by kind of dental braces you desire, your dental plan, as well as where you stay in the U.S.

Lingual braces are braces that are attached to the back of the teeth as opposed to the front making them practically unseen to individuals around you.

Unfortunately there are some bite conditions that can not be treated with lingual dental braces. Individuals with a deep overbite are bad candidates for lingual braces due to the fact that the overbite might put excessive pressure on the braces bring about the brackets falling off.
